Pecan Pie: The Irresistible Secret to Perfect Holiday Desserts

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 (9-inch) pie crust, unbaked
  • 1 cup corn syrup
  • 1 cup brown sugar, packed
  • 1/3 cup unsalted butter, melted
  • 3 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1 1/2 cups pecans, chopped or whole

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. In a large mixing bowl, combine corn syrup, brown sugar, melted butter, eggs, vanilla extract, and salt. Whisk until well combined.
  3. Stir in the pecans until evenly distributed.
  4. Pour the filling into the unbaked pie crust, spreading the pecans evenly.
  5. Bake in the preheated oven for 60 to 70 minutes, or until the filling is set and the top is golden brown.
  6. Remove from the oven and allow to cool for at least 2 hours before slicing.

Notes

  • Serve with whipped cream or vanilla ice cream for extra indulgence.
  • Store leftovers in the refrigerator for up to 4 days.
